What is jdependency
jdependency is small library that helps you analyze class level dependencies, clashes and missing classes.

Install jdependency on CentOS 7 Using yum
Update yum database with yum
using the following command.
sudo yum makecache
After updating yum database, We can install jdependency
using yum
by running the following command:
sudo yum -y install jdependency

How To Uninstall jdependency on CentOS 7
To uninstall only the jdependency
package we can use the following command:
sudo dnf remove jdependency
